Students will investigate financial literacy through a variety of authentic tasks that prepare them for the future but inspire them now! 

Students to analyse their strengths and interests to see what career options align and build an online resume based off skills gained from everyday tasks such as household chores, participating in sports, or being an older sibling. They have the opportunity to practice an online job interview and land a pretend job!

From here we use Google Sheets to calculate where our pay goes when it doesn’t go in our pocket! We look at how different careers have different entry requirements - apprenticeships, university, or working up the ladder - and how these, as well as income levels, can affect income tax, Kiwisaver rates and student loan repayments.

Once we have our net income it’s time to start spending! Students are challenged to ration their incomes to afford food, shelter, and clothing. We use online websites such as TradeMe to find a flat, Countdown to budget weekly groceries, online clothing stores and more! Gain a realistic appreciation of day-to-day financial commitments.
